Discover the Unique Culture of Papua New Guinea

Papua New Guinea is a country with a unique and diverse culture. It is one of the most culturally diverse nations in the world, with over 820 different languages spoken across the islands. The culture is based on traditions that have been passed down by the ancestors, and many of the traditional practices are still observed today.

The people of Papua New Guinea are largely Melanesian and live in small, rural villages. Their traditional lifestyle is based on fishing, hunting, and gardening. The arts are also very important in the culture and include wood carving, weaving, painting, and singing. Traditional dancing and singing are also very popular.

Religion plays an important role in the culture of Papua New Guinea. The majority of the people are Christian, although there are still some traditional beliefs and practices. Some of these beliefs include ancestor worship, belief in the power of sorcery, and belief in the power of dreams.

The cuisine of Papua New Guinea is also very diverse and is made up of a variety of different dishes. Some of the most popular dishes include sweet potatoes, taro, and yams. Fish is also a popular food, as are fruits, vegetables, and nuts.

The people of Papua New Guinea are known for their hospitality and friendliness. They are very welcoming to visitors, and there is a strong sense of community in the country.

Uncover the Natural Wonders of Papua New Guinea

Papua New Guinea is an island nation located in the South Pacific Ocean, just north of Australia. With its rugged terrain and lush rainforests, Papua New Guinea is a natural paradise that is home to some of the world’s most unique and diverse wildlife. From the incredible array of birds, bats and other animals that inhabit the forests, to the stunning coral reefs and crystal clear waters that surround the island, Papua New Guinea offers a variety of natural wonders that draw adventurers and nature-lovers from around the world.

One of the many natural wonders of Papua New Guinea is the enormous variety of birds that call the island home. The island is home to over 700 species of birds, including some of the most exotic and beautiful species in the world. From the vibrant red-breasted pygmy parrot to the striking Golden-Shouldered Parakeet, the birdlife of Papua New Guinea is truly spectacular.

In addition to its incredible birdlife, Papua New Guinea is also home to an array of fascinating mammals. From the cuscus, a type of marsupial, to the rare tree kangaroo, the island is home to a variety of unique animals that are found nowhere else in the world. The most famous of these is the endangered Tree Kangaroo, which can only be found in the mountains of Papua New Guinea.

The waters surrounding Papua New Guinea are also home to a variety of stunning coral reefs and marine life. The reefs are teeming with colorful fish, turtles, and other sea creatures, making it a popular destination for snorkelers and scuba divers. The crystal clear waters offer an incredible opportunity to explore the many species that inhabit the reef, from the brilliantly colored clownfish to the graceful manta ray.
